## Signing Pipeline
|
|
|
|
The build pipeline is a sequence of standalone scripts:
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
build-release.sh
|
|
├── cargo bundle --release --bin galaxy-oss --package galaxy
|
|
├── sign.sh --release
|
|
├── notarize.sh --release
|
|
└── package.sh --release
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
### sign.sh
|
|
- Signs `Galaxy.app` with Samsung Developer ID cert
|
|
- Uses hardened runtime (`--options runtime`)
|
|
- Signs inside-out (binary first, then bundle)
|
|
- Uses `--timestamp` on all codesign calls
|
|
- Entitlements from `BuildSupport/Galaxy.entitlements`
|
|
|
|
### notarize.sh
|
|
- Creates zip of Galaxy.app
|
|
- Submits to Apple notary service via `xcrun notarytool submit`
|
|
- Uses inline credentials (NOT keychain profile — doesn't work from Galaxy terminal)
|
|
- Waits for acceptance, then staples ticket
|
|
|
|
### package.sh
|
|
- Creates DMG with app + /Applications symlink via `hdiutil`
|
|
- Signs the DMG
|
|
- Notarizes the DMG (same inline credentials)
|
|
- Staples ticket to DMG
|
|
|
|
### Entitlements (BuildSupport/Galaxy.entitlements)
|
|
- `com.apple.security.network.client` — outbound network
|
|
- `com.apple.security.automation.apple-events` — AppleScript
|
|
- `com.apple.security.cs.allow-unsigned-executable-memory` — Metal/wgpu shader compilation

## Known Issues
|
|
|
|
1. **Keychain profile doesn't work from Galaxy terminal** — `xcrun notarytool store-credentials` requires interactive macOS keychain authorization dialog. Galaxy (as a non-standard terminal) can't show it. Workaround: inline credentials in scripts.
|
|
|
|
2. **hdiutil "Resource busy"** — Sometimes the first `hdiutil create` attempt fails. Scripts retry up to 3 times with 3s delay.
|
|
|
|
